Alaska SeaLife Center, Seward, Alaska. 74K likes · 44,680 were here. The ASLC combines a public aquarium with research, education, and wildlife response in Seward, AK.
Specialties: The Alaska SeaLife Center is a private non-profit organization that generates and shares scientific knowledge to promote understanding and stewardship of Alaska's marine ecosystems. Established in 1990. The Alaska SeaLife Center was established shortly after the Exxon Valdez oil spill in 1989. Today we are Alaska's only public aquarium and permanent marine wildlife rehabilitation ...

The Alaska SeaLife Center (ASLC) admitted a male northern sea otter pup to the Wildlife Response Program on October 31, 2023, the third pup rescued this year. The approximately three-week-old pup arrived late Halloween night after a long transport from the remote coastal town of Seldovia, AK, and is currently under 24-hour care by wildlife ...

In 1993, the Alaska Legislature appropriated $12.5 million from the EVOS criminal settlement funds as a state grant to the City of Seward to develop the Alaska SeaLife Center as a "marine mammal rehabilitation center and as a center for education and research related to the natural resources injured by EVOS."
